Transaction 60de95738d4b960341959656cf5045927a7c134934bc6e5afdb0985cba0ed4ca

2 Input
2 Outputs
  • 60de95738d4b960341959656cf5045927a7c134934bc6e5afdb0985cba0ed4ca:0
  • value  1870286
    address  36dfQfy4BNoLfdhNSX7B36hJnbQQ3U3Da5
  • 60de95738d4b960341959656cf5045927a7c134934bc6e5afdb0985cba0ed4ca:1
  • value  53510
    address  15k29ftPNXdHi55vunZjE3wAL1iwc5LsgX